//! Directed-acyclic graph implementation.
|
|
#![warn(missing_docs)]
|
|
use std::{
|
|
borrow::Borrow,
|
|
cmp::Ordering,
|
|
collections::{BTreeMap, BTreeSet, VecDeque},
|
|
fmt,
|
|
ops::{ControlFlow, Deref, Index},
|
|
};
|
|
|
|
/// A node in the graph.
|
|
#[derive(Clone, Debug, PartialEq, Eq)]
|
|
pub struct Node<K, V> {
|
|
/// The node value, stored by the user.
|
|
pub value: V,
|
|
/// Nodes depended on.
|
|
pub dependencies: BTreeSet<K>,
|
|
/// Nodes depending on this node.
|
|
pub dependents: BTreeSet<K>,
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
impl<K, V> Node<K, V> {
|
|
fn new(value: V) -> Self {
|
|
Self {
|
|
value,
|
|
dependencies: BTreeSet::new(),
|
|
dependents: BTreeSet::new(),
|
|
}
|
|
}
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
impl<K, V> Borrow<V> for &Node<K, V> {
|
|
fn borrow(&self) -> &V {
|
|
&self.value
|
|
}
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
impl<K, V> Deref for Node<K, V> {
|
|
type Target = V;
|
|
|
|
fn deref(&self) -> &Self::Target {
|
|
&self.value
|
|
}
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
/// A directed acyclic graph.
|
|
#[derive(Clone, Debug, Default, PartialEq, Eq)]
|
|
pub struct Dag<K, V> {
|
|
graph: BTreeMap<K, Node<K, V>>,
|
|
tips: BTreeSet<K>,
|
|
roots: BTreeSet<K>,
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
impl<K: Ord + Copy, V> Dag<K, V> {
|
|
/// Create a new empty DAG.
|
|
pub fn new() -> Self {
|
|
Self {
|
|
graph: BTreeMap::new(),
|
|
tips: BTreeSet::new(),
|
|
roots: BTreeSet::new(),
|
|
}
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
/// Create a DAG with a root node.
|
|
pub fn root(key: K, value: V) -> Self {
|
|
Self {
|
|
graph: BTreeMap::from_iter([(key, Node::new(value))]),
|
|
tips: BTreeSet::from_iter([key]),
|
|
roots: BTreeSet::from_iter([key]),
|
|
}
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
/// Check whether there are any nodes in the graph.
|
|
pub fn is_empty(&self) -> bool {
|
|
self.graph.is_empty()
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
/// Return the number of nodes in the graph.
|
|
pub fn len(&self) -> usize {
|
|
self.graph.len()
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
/// Add a node to the graph.
|
|
pub fn node(&mut self, key: K, value: V) -> Option<Node<K, V>> {
|
|
self.tips.insert(key);
|
|
self.roots.insert(key);
|
|
self.graph.insert(
|
|
key,
|
|
Node {
|
|
value,
|
|
dependencies: BTreeSet::new(),
|
|
dependents: BTreeSet::new(),
|
|
},
|
|
)
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
/// Add a dependency from one node to the other.
|
|
pub fn dependency(&mut self, from: K, to: K) {
|
|
if let Some(node) = self.graph.get_mut(&from) {
|
|
node.dependencies.insert(to);
|
|
self.roots.remove(&from);
|
|
}
|
|
if let Some(node) = self.graph.get_mut(&to) {
|
|
node.dependents.insert(from);
|
|
self.tips.remove(&to);
|
|
}
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
/// Check if the graph contains a node.
|
|
pub fn contains(&self, key: &K) -> bool {
|
|
self.graph.contains_key(key)
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
/// Get a node.
|
|
pub fn get(&self, key: &K) -> Option<&Node<K, V>> {
|
|
self.graph.get(key)
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
/// Check whether there is a dependency between two nodes.
|
|
pub fn has_dependency(&self, from: &K, to: &K) -> bool {
|
|
self.graph
|
|
.get(from)
|
|
.map(|n| n.dependencies.contains(to))
|
|
.unwrap_or_default()
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
/// Get the graph's root nodes, ie. nodes which don't depend on other nodes.
|
|
pub fn roots(&self) -> impl Iterator<Item = (&K, &Node<K, V>)> + '_ {
|
|
self.roots
|
|
.iter()
|
|
.filter_map(|k| self.graph.get(k).map(|n| (k, n)))
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
/// Get the graph's tip nodes, ie. nodes which aren't depended on by other nodes.
|
|
pub fn tips(&self) -> impl Iterator<Item = (&K, &Node<K, V>)> + '_ {
|
|
self.tips
|
|
.iter()
|
|
.filter_map(|k| self.graph.get(k).map(|n| (k, n)))
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
/// Merge a DAG into this one.
|
|
pub fn merge(&mut self, mut other: Self) {
|
|
let Some((root, _)) = other.roots().next() else {
|
|
return;
|
|
};
|
|
let mut visited = BTreeSet::new();
|
|
let mut queue = VecDeque::<K>::from([*root]);
|
|
|
|
while let Some(next) = queue.pop_front() {
|
|
if !visited.insert(next) {
|
|
continue;
|
|
}
|
|
if let Some(node) = other.graph.remove(&next) {
|
|
if !self.contains(&next) {
|
|
self.node(next, node.value);
|
|
}
|
|
for k in &node.dependents {
|
|
self.dependency(*k, next);
|
|
}
|
|
for k in &node.dependencies {
|
|
self.dependency(next, *k);
|
|
}
|
|
queue.extend(node.dependents.iter());
|
|
}
|
|
}
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
/// Return a topological ordering of the graph's nodes.
|
|
/// Uses a comparison function to sort partially ordered nodes.
|
|
pub fn sorted<F>(&self, mut compare: F) -> Vec<K>
|
|
where
|
|
F: FnMut(&K, &K) -> Ordering,
|
|
{
|
|
let mut order = Vec::new(); // Stores the topological order.
|
|
let mut visited = BTreeSet::new(); // Nodes that have been visited.
|
|
let mut keys = self.graph.keys().collect::<Vec<_>>();
|
|
|
|
keys.sort_by(|a, b| compare(a, b));
|
|
|
|
for node in keys {
|
|
self.visit(node, &mut visited, &mut order);
|
|
}
|
|
order
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
/// Fold over the graph in topological order, pruning branches along the way.
|
|
///
|
|
/// To continue traversing a branch, return [`ControlFlow::Continue`] from the
|
|
/// filter function. To stop traversal of a branch, return [`ControlFlow::Break`].
|
|
pub fn fold<A, F>(&self, roots: &[K], mut acc: A, mut filter: F) -> A
|
|
where
|
|
F: for<'r> FnMut(A, &'r K, &'r Node<K, V>) -> ControlFlow<A, A>,
|
|
{
|
|
let mut visited = BTreeSet::new();
|
|
let mut queue = VecDeque::<K>::from_iter(roots.iter().cloned());
|
|
|
|
while let Some(next) = queue.pop_front() {
|
|
if !visited.insert(next) {
|
|
continue;
|
|
}
|
|
if let Some(node) = self.graph.get(&next) {
|
|
match filter(acc, &next, node) {
|
|
ControlFlow::Continue(a) => {
|
|
queue.extend(node.dependents.iter().cloned());
|
|
acc = a;
|
|
}
|
|
ControlFlow::Break(a) => {
|
|
// When filtering out a node, we filter out all transitive dependents on
|
|
// that node by adding them to the already visited list.
|
|
visited.extend(self.descendants_of(node));
|
|
acc = a;
|
|
}
|
|
}
|
|
}
|
|
}
|
|
acc
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
fn descendants_of(&self, from: &Node<K, V>) -> Vec<K> {
|
|
let mut visited = BTreeSet::new();
|
|
let mut stack = VecDeque::new();
|
|
let mut nodes = Vec::new();
|
|
|
|
stack.extend(from.dependents.iter());
|
|
|
|
while let Some(key) = stack.pop_front() {
|
|
if let Some(node) = self.graph.get(&key) {
|
|
if visited.insert(key) {
|
|
nodes.push(key);
|
|
|
|
for &neighbour in &node.dependents {
|
|
stack.push_back(neighbour);
|
|
}
|
|
}
|
|
}
|
|
}
|
|
nodes
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
/// Add nodes recursively to the topological order, starting from the given node.
|
|
fn visit(&self, key: &K, visited: &mut BTreeSet<K>, order: &mut Vec<K>) {
|
|
if visited.contains(key) {
|
|
return;
|
|
}
|
|
visited.insert(*key);
|
|
|
|
// Recursively visit all of the node's dependencies.
|
|
if let Some(node) = self.graph.get(key) {
|
|
for dependency in &node.dependencies {
|
|
self.visit(dependency, visited, order);
|
|
}
|
|
}
|
|
// Add the node to the topological order.
|
|
order.push(*key);
|
|
}
|
|
}
